What is Kyoh®?

Kyoh® is a scientifically developed extract obtained from the leaves of Eruca sativa, characterized by a well-defined phytochemical composition and standardized to contain more than 1.5% Erucosides®, Pharmactive’s proprietary complex of flavonol glycosides naturally occurring in rocket leaves. Using HPLC analytical methods, Kyoh® delivers a consistent flavonol glycoside profile ranging from 1.5% to 3.0%, primarily composed of quercetin, kaempferol, and isorhamnetin derivatives, supporting high batch-to-batch uniformity and quality consistency.

The flavonol compounds naturally present in Kyoh® have been investigated for their antioxidant properties and their involvement in biological processes related to follicular activity, including pathways associated with cellular defense and hair follicle support*.

The quality profile of Kyoh® is supported by controlled European sourcing practices, careful raw material selection, and a proprietary manufacturing process developed to maintain the stability, integrity, and reproducibility of its characteristic phytochemical profile.

How does it work?

The following mechanisms have been investigated for Kyoh®:

  • Support of biological pathways associated with hair follicle function and the normal hair growth cycle*.
  • Promotion of growth factor expression linked to follicular activity, including VEGF and FGF7*.
  • Activation of antioxidant response pathways involved in cellular protection, including NRF2-related mechanisms*.
  • Support in protecting follicular cells from oxidative stress and environmental damage*.

Follicle-focused biological research

Kyoh® was assessed in a recent in vitro investigation using cultured human dermal papilla cells, a well-recognized model in hair follicle biology research.

The study findings showed increased expression of VEGF and FGF7, signaling pathways involved in follicular physiology and hair follicle activity*. Kyoh® also demonstrated activation of NRF2-associated antioxidant pathways related to cellular defense mechanisms and protection against oxidative stress*.

Additionally, the extract supported dermal papilla cell activity, highlighting its potential as a targeted botanical ingredient for next-generation beauty-from-within formulations focused on follicle health and hair wellness.

Controlled European sourcing

Kyoh® is manufactured from selected Eruca sativa cultivated in Europe under carefully managed agricultural conditions aimed at maintaining high standards of raw material quality and consistency.

The leaves are collected at a specific stage of development to help preserve their naturally occurring flavonol glycosides, including the compounds standardized as Erucosides®*.

Together with Pharmactive’s proprietary extraction and analytical technologies, this sourcing approach supports traceability, batch-to-batch consistency, and a well-characterized phytochemical profile suitable for advanced nutricosmetic applications.
